- [focusurgent](https://dwm.suckless.org/patches/focusurgent/)
- adds a keyboard shortcut to select the next window having the urgent flag regardless of the tag it is on
- [fsignal](https://dwm.suckless.org/patches/fsignal/)
- send "fake signals" to dwm for handling, using xsetroot
- this will not conflict with the status bar, which also is managed using xsetroot
- [fullscreen](https://dwm.suckless.org/patches/fullscreen/)
- applies the monocle layout with the focused client on top and hides the bar
- when pressed again it shows the bar and restores the layout that was active before going fullscreen

int
fake_signal(void)
{
char fsignal[256];
char indicator[9] = "fsignal:";
char str_signum[16];
int i, v, signum;
size_t len_fsignal, len_indicator = strlen(indicator);
// Get root name property
if (gettextprop(root, XA_WM_NAME, fsignal, sizeof(fsignal))) {
len_fsignal = strlen(fsignal);
// Check if this is indeed a fake signal
if (len_indicator > len_fsignal ? 0 : strncmp(indicator, fsignal, len_indicator) == 0) {
memcpy(str_signum, &fsignal[len_indicator], len_fsignal - len_indicator);
str_signum[len_fsignal - len_indicator] = '\0';
// Convert string value into managable integer
for (i = signum = 0; i < strlen(str_signum); i++) {
v = str_signum[i] - '0';
if (v >= 0 && v <= 9) {
signum = signum * 10 + v;
}
}
// Check if a signal was found, and if so handle it
if (signum)
for (i = 0; i < LENGTH(signals); i++)
if (signum == signals[i].signum && signals[i].func)
signals[i].func(&(signals[i].arg));
// A fake signal was sent
return 1;
}
}
// No fake signal was sent, so proceed with update
return 0;
}

/* By default, dwm responds to _NET_ACTIVE_WINDOW client messages by setting
* the urgency bit on the named window. This patch activates the window instead.
* https://dwm.suckless.org/patches/focusonnetactive/
*/
#define FOCUSONNETACTIVE_PATCH 0
/* Send "fake signals" to dwm for handling, using xsetroot. This will not conflict with the
* status bar, which also is managed using xsetroot.
* Also see the dwmc patch, which takes precedence over this patch.
* https://dwm.suckless.org/patches/fsignal/
*/
#define FSIGNAL_PATCH 0
